  • Q: Why are some areas password protected?
    A: These areas are password protested to ensure their use by health care practitioners who have achieved basic competency in arthritis management. One of the ways of being considered as arthritis care competent is to attend the Arthritis Continuing Education (ACE) course, “Introduction to the Assessment and Management of Rheumatic Diseases”.
